-
Edison Smart®

Software Developer (Mobile & Embedded Systems)

Edison Smart®
Canada · Contract · Not Applicable

Software Developer (Mobile & Embedded Systems) – Contract

Location: Onsite in Montreal, Full-Time

My client are revolutionizing mobile satellite communications by extending connectivity to remote and underserved areas. Through innovative solutions, they bridge the gap between mobile network providers and satellite communications, enabling seamless connectivity for IoT devices and mobile phones.

Job Overview

They are seeking a Software Developer with experience in mobile applications, embedded technologies, and IoT connectivity to support and accelerate the development of a cutting-edge application. This role is contract-based with the potential for a full-time hire and will require onsite work in the Montreal lab. You will work closely with thier supplier to accelerate product development and enhance connectivity solutions for IoT devices, wireless networks, and mobile communications.

Key Responsibilities:
  • Collaborate with thier supplier to support and accelerate mobile and embedded application development.
  • Design, develop, and test new features for mobile applications and embedded systems.
  • Ensure seamless device-to-cloud connectivity via APIs for IoT and mobile devices.
  • Work with low-level hardware, chipsets, and RTOS to optimize device performance.
  • Develop and maintain full-stack applications, with a focus on front-end development when required.
  • Troubleshoot and resolve wireless connectivity issues across multiple platforms.
  • Conduct testing, validation, and performance tuning for new and existing features.
  • Work in a hands-on lab environment with hardware and embedded systems.
Requirements:
  • Strong experience in JavaScript and/or Android development (React Native, Kotlin, Java, or similar).
  • Experience with embedded systems, chipsets, RTOS, and low-level hardware programming.
  • Knowledge of IoT device connectivity, wireless communication protocols, and APIs.
  • Full-stack development experience, with front-end skills being a plus.
  • Hands-on experience in testing and validating mobile and embedded applications.
  • Ability to work onsite in Montreal in a lab environment.
  • Strong problem-solving and debugging skills.
If you're a talented developer passionate about, embedded systems, and IoT connectivity, apply today!

In partnership with our clients, Edison Smart welcomes applications from candidates of all backgrounds, experiences, and perspectives. We are committed to fostering diversity and inclusion in the workplace. As a global specialist in Smart technology talent solutions, we connect expert technologists with opportunities that drive the ‘Industry 4.0’ revolution.


Due to the high volume of applications, it is not always possible to respond to unsuccessful applicants. Therefore, if we have not responded to your application within five days, please assume that on this occasion your application has not been successful.

Key Skills

Ranked by relevance

embedded embedded systems wireless react native android kotlin react cloud java rtos
Login to Apply
Posted
Mar 06, 2025
Type
Contract
Level
Not Applicable
Location
Montreal

Industries

Aviation Aerospace Component Manufacturing Defense Space Manufacturing

Categories

Information Technology

Related Jobs

3 roles aligned with this opportunity

View all jobs
View Job Details
Thales
Related

Mechanical Engineer

2026-05-29

Full-time
Not Applicable
Belgium
Aviation
Engineering
View Job Details
Thales
Related

[S3NS] Développeur Golang confirmé (H/F)

2026-05-28

Full-time
Not Applicable
France
Aviation
Engineering
View Job Details
Harmattan AI
Related

Software Engineer - Validation

2026-05-27

Full-time
Not Applicable
Switzerland
Defense
Engineering